About the dying part of this game, I think it would be more immersive if you didn't die as often. Now I'm all for games being challenging, but I also hate dying. It shatters immersion and if you haven't quicksaved recently, It's a real pain. I think that there should be a chance for the character to go down, critically injured and unconscious. Then you could either wake up in the same spot a few hours later, presumed dead and abandoned by your enemies. Or, like with the frostfall mod for skyrim, there would be a chance that a friendly wanderer finds and saves you. You would wake up in a nearby settlement. Or maybe your companion was able to drag you out of combat and to safety. I think this would be cool. And I'm not saying that your character should be totally unkillable, if a bottlecap mine goes off in your unarmored face, your dead. But there could be a chance to become unconscious if your health drops to 0 +/- like 10 or something. I don't know, but then even if you go down, you would still be like "oh no, am I dead?" and there would still be hope that your character survived.
